The author of the Sai Leela is called Hemadpant. Can you describe his personality before he began writing and why this name is significant?

📖 Chapter 2

The author, referred to as Hemadpant, provides a candid self-description of his initial character in Chapter 2. Before undertaking this sacred work, he describes himself as mischievous, talkative, cynical, and critical. He admits to being arrogant about his knowledge, possessing a logic-driven mind, and being prone to argumentation. He knew nothing of a Satguru's greatness and was always proud of his own wisdom. The author promises to tell the full story of how he received the name "Hemadpant" later, explaining that this naming ceremony is a significant sub-story within the larger narrative of Sai’s life.
